NEW YORK (AP) - Major League Baseball says it will adhere to a Senate committee's request for documents detailing betting investigations.


Sens. Ted Cruz and Maria Cantwell of the Commerce, Science, and Transportation Committee sent a letter Monday to baseball Commissioner Rob Manfred asking for info by Dec. 5. The demand followed indictments of Cleveland pitchers Emmanuel Clase and Luis Ortiz implicating them of taking allurements to rig pitches for . Both have pleaded not guilty.


"We ´ re going to react totally and cooperatively and on time to the Senate query," Manfred said Wednesday throughout a news conference at an owners meeting.


Two days after the indictments were unsealed on Nov. 9, MLB said its licensed gaming operators will cap bets on specific pitches at $200 and exclude them from parlays.


"We think the steps we ´ ve taken in terms of limiting the size of these prop bets and restricting parlays off them is an actually, truly significant change that needs to lower the reward for anybody to be included in an unsuitable way," Manfred stated.


He said it was too early to state whether MLB will take a stance on prediction markets, in which agreements are traded based upon actual occasions such as game ratings.


"We ´ re aware of the concerns, the various regulatory structure, however not in a position where I want to articulate publicly a position on it," he stated.


Manfred said MLB's internal investigation into the Cleveland pitchers didn't have a schedule. Ortiz was positioned on paid leave on July 3 and Clase on July 28. They are not on track to accrue additional income up until opening day on March 25.


"We think that we should take benefit of the offseason to make certain that we conduct the most comprehensive and complete examination possible," Manfred stated.


MLB is aiding players who have actually received threats related to betting following the 2018 U.S. Supreme Court judgment that legislated sports wagering in many states.


"We have had in place for some time services that are available to players that receive threats of this kind in regards to providing support through police," he stated. "We do take it as a very major issue and do supply assistance on a continuous basis."


Manfred prevented discussing management's positions in collective bargaining for a labor agreement to change the deal that expires in December 2026 and whether MLB intends to press for an income cap system.


"We have a considerable segment of our fans that have been vocal about the problem of competitive balance and in basic we try to take note of our fans, so it is a topic of discussion," was the most he would say.


MLB is anticipated to lock out gamers on Dec. 2, 2026, in order to attempt to get a contract without reducing the 2027 season.


"There has never ever been a lost video game since I became included as an employee of baseball and it is my goal to get this next one done keeping that record intact," stated Manfred, who joined the MLB staff in 1998. "It ´ s a great deal of work to be done in between now and then, however that ´ s my goal."


The amateur draft is going up a day to the Saturday before the All-Star Game and the Futures Game is being pushed back to Sunday and will be followed by a new event with previous gamers and celebs. NBC will televise the first hour of the draft and the rest of the round on Peacock and the MLB Network. NBC also will telecast the Futures Game.


The Field of Dreams Game will resume on Aug. 13 with Minnesota playing Philadelphia at Dyersville, Iowa, which Netflix will stream. The Field of Dreams, website of the 1989 movie, hosted the Yankees and White Sox in 2021, and the Cubs and Reds the following year before closing for restorations. The Triple-A St. Paul Saints deal with the Iowa Cubs at the exact same website on Aug. 11.


Manfred said MLB prepares to play in Iowa routinely however possibly not yearly.


Milwaukee will play Atlanta in the Little League Classic at Williamsport, Pennsylvania, on Aug. 23.


MLB signed a six-year arrangement through 2031 with PitchCom, the electronic device for catchers to signify pitches the sport has actually used considering that 2022.


"It ´ s been necessary both in terms of moving the video game along and deterrence of indication stealing," Manfred said.


Tampa Bay stays on track to return to Tropicana Field in St. Petersburg, Florida, for its home opener versus the Chicago Cubs on April 6 after a year of home games at Steinbrenner Field in Tampa, the spring training home of the New York Yankees. The Rays were required from their ballpark by damage from Hurricane Milton.


"I think they only have two panels left, I believe, and they anticipate the roofing to be dried out the first week in December, which is an actually crucial milestone for us," he stated. "There ´ s going to be new turf and padding, brand-new floor covering throughout, restorations of the suites, the seating locations. All the air quality tests have actually returned great."
